About Technical Account Manager

  The ideal Technical Account Manager (TAM) prioritizes their customers' success, communicates exceptionally well, acts professionally, strives to exceed expectations, enjoys building relationships, collaborates effectively with others, and can quickly learn new technologies. As a trusted advisor, the TAM will demonstrate their customer success track record by communicating effectively with partners and leveraging their extensive knowledge of the Influxdata platform to provide solutions that meet the customers' business needs. They will forge strong relationships with their customers and account teams, develop a deep technical understanding of their Influxdata implementation, and share best practices to provide proactive services. When significant incidents occur, the TAM will act as the point of contact, taking ownership of the customer's expectations and communication throughout the resolution process.

  InfluxData takes a market-based approach to pay, and pay may vary depending on your location. U.S. locations are categorized into two zones based on a cost of labor index for that geographic area. The offered starting salary will be determined based on the candidate's job-related skills, experience, qualifications, work location, and market conditions. Ranges are evaluated on a periodic basis and are subject to change at the Company's discretion.

  Zone 1 Range: $90,900-168,200

  Zone 2 Range: $75,700-107,900

  To find a location's zone designation or for additional information, please speak to your recruiter.

  In addition to a competitive base salary, InfluxData offers comprehensive and inclusive employee benefits including medical, dental, vision, and mental health benefits, a 401(k) plan, flexible paid time off, home office or co-working reimbursements, and participation in InfluxData's equity program (where applicable).
